Favre Leuba expands Deep Raider collection with a new power reserve model
Favre Leuba expands Deep Raider collection with a new power reserve model
Chronoholic News Desk
Jul 28, 2026

Favre Leuba has expanded its Deep Raider Renaissance line with the introduction of a new power reserve indicator model – the Deep Raider Power Reserve now comes with an added functionality while retaining its dive watch character. 

Rooted in the legacy of the 1964 Deep Blue dive watch, the latest model features a round 40 mm stainless steel case with a thickness of 12.59 mm. The case combines brushed and polished finishes, highlighted by sculpted contours, tapered lugs, and polished edges. A curved sapphire crystal with an anti-reflective coating protects the dial, while a knurled screw-in crown ensures secure handling. The unidirectional rotating dive bezel features a durable ceramic insert and a luminous pip at 12 o’clock for underwater timing. Completing the construction is a closed caseback bearing Favre Leuba’s historic emblem within a wave-inspired motif and the inscription “Conquering Frontiers Since 1737.” The model is water-resistant to 300 metres.

The dial is available in white, black, green, blue, and ice-blue colourways, featuring a sunray finish that radiates from the centre to create dynamic light reflections. The small seconds display at 9 o’clock and the power reserve indicator at 6 o’clock are distinguished by snailed sub-dials with concentric circular finishing. A vertical triple-figure date aperture sits at 3 o’clock, with all displays framed by raised metallic surrounds. Applied rhodium-plated indexes and polished rhodium-plated hour and minute hands ensure a refined appearance, while Super-LumiNova C1 X1 filling on the hands, indexes, and bezel pip emits a blue glow for clear visibility in low-light and underwater conditions. The power reserve indicator incorporates a red warning segment to signal when the movement is running low on power.

Powering the watch is the automatic FLP01 calibre, operating at a frequency of 28,800 vibrations per hour (4 Hz). The movement contains 26 jewels and delivers a 41-hour power reserve, driving a triple-figure date indication, small seconds, and the remaining power displayed through the dedicated indicator at 6 o’clock.

The model is paired with an integrated stainless steel bracelet featuring a triple-link construction with alternating brushed and polished surfaces. The bracelet is secured by a butterfly clasp and incorporates a tool-free quick-change system.

The Favre Leuba Deep Raider Power Reserve is priced at INR 2,95,000. Joining a collection that has evolved from the Deep Raider Revival and subsequent Renaissance editions, this release further expands the collection’s mechanical capabilities while maintaining its focus on performance-driven dive watchmaking. The watch is now part of Favre Leuba’s contemporary portfolio, which continues to blend the brand’s historic design heritage with modern Swiss mechanical watchmaking.
